My perspective is strictly short term. I am referring to a very brief period—at most two to three weeks—when rate cuts are too short-lived to have any meaningful impact on long-term yields, but the yield curve still widens. The reason this short window matters right now is that based on the number of TrustPilot reviews, Upstart’s Q3 2025 revenue estimate appears likely to fall below guidance. The Q3 earnings release is especially critical for investors.

This comes against the backdrop of other fintech companies showing notable stock price appreciation this year. By contrast, Upstart Holdings, despite beating guidance in both its May and August earnings releases, saw its stock decline due to ineffective investor relations.

From a long-term perspective, however, you are absolutely right. Most of Upstart’s potential banking clients lack deep technical expertise and therefore require the kind of long-term proof of default rates and returns that FICO has established over decades. It is true that Upstart has the advantage of having endured a high-rate environment and accumulated valuable data, yet it still cannot match the heritage and track record that FICO possesses.

That said, I firmly believe, as you pointed out, that Upstart will prove itself the superior alternative by demonstrating stronger returns and lower default rates relative to FICO. This is precisely why I remain confident in investing in the company.
